The United States is undergoing a significant demographic shift similar to trends seen in other developed nations, such as Japan, marked by a steadily expanding senior population. This aging demographic is set to become one of the most influential segments of society, shaping consumer behavior, spending habits, and market priorities across a wide range of industries. Two major forces are driving this transformation: increased life expectancy fueled by advances in healthcare, and declining birth rates that are gradually reshaping the nation’s age distribution. As a result, businesses, policymakers, and service providers must adapt to the evolving needs and expectations of an older population that will play an increasingly central role in economic and social decision-making.
One of the primary contributors to this shift is progress in medical science and technology. Advances in healthcare have transformed many once-fatal or life-limiting conditions into manageable or treatable illnesses. Improvements in diagnostics, pharmaceuticals, surgical techniques, preventive care, and personalized medicine have significantly extended both lifespan and quality of life. Today’s seniors are often healthier, more active, and capable of enjoying long post-retirement years that may span decades. This evolution is redefining aging and increasing demand for products, services, and experiences tailored to a population that values longevity, wellness, and independence. As a result, industries ranging from healthcare and housing to travel, fitness, and financial services are rethinking how they serve older consumers.
A second major factor shaping this demographic transition is the changing economic environment. Rising costs for housing, healthcare, education, and childcare have made raising children more financially challenging for many families. In contrast to earlier generations—when single-income households could often support larger families—today’s economic realities frequently require dual incomes, even for modest living standards. For many younger adults, particularly millennials and Gen Z, the financial burden associated with parenthood has led to delayed family planning, smaller households, or decisions to forgo having children altogether. Combined with increased longevity, this trend is accelerating the growth of the senior population and reshaping the overall age structure of the country, creating long-term implications for consumer markets, labor dynamics, and economic planning.

As people grow older, the natural aging process often brings a gradual decline in physical strength, flexibility, and endurance, even for those who were once highly active and fit. This reduction in physical capabilities can make everyday tasks more challenging, sometimes leading to significant mobility issues that require the use of assistive devices such as walkers, canes, or wheelchairs. Maintaining independence becomes a top priority for many seniors, especially when it comes to living safely and comfortably in their own homes. To support this, a variety of adaptive products and services have become increasingly important. Smart home innovations, including automated lighting, voice-activated controls, adjustable furniture, and other accessibility-focused technologies, help reduce physical strain and enhance daily convenience. Practical services such as home cleaning, yard care, meal delivery, and transportation assistance further empower seniors to manage household responsibilities with ease.
Along with physical changes, aging often brings an increase in medical needs, as many seniors begin managing health conditions that become part of everyday life. These may include chronic issues such as arthritis, which can limit mobility, as well as heart disease, high blood pressure, diabetes, and other age-related concerns. While the severity of these conditions varies from individual to individual, most can be managed on an ongoing basis without the need for constant hospital care.Advancements in healthcare have made it possible for many seniors to effectively manage their health from the comfort of their own homes. Prescription medications, health-monitoring devices, mobility supports, and specialized medical equipment now enable older adults to maintain independence, safety, and quality of life in familiar surroundings. Seniors are becoming an increasingly influential force in the political arena, demonstrating high levels of civic participation across a wide range of activities. Many older adults actively engage in grassroots efforts, volunteer for political campaigns, contribute financially to candidates or causes, and advocate for policies that reflect their values and priorities. Retirement often provides more time to stay informed, enabling seniors to closely follow political developments through news broadcasts, digital media, social platforms, and talk radio.
One of the most defining characteristics of this demographic is its strong commitment to voting. Seniors consistently record higher voter turnout rates than younger age groups, making them one of the most reliable segments of the electorate. Their consistent participation at the polls gives them considerable influence over election outcomes and public policy decisions.
